Dundy County authorities looking for two people wanted on drug-related charges

Two Haigler residents are wanted on drug-related charges.


According to Dundy County Court Records, Louis Cox, 68, is charged with 8 total counts, including Possession With Intent to Distribute within 1,000 feet of a Playground and Possession of a Deadly Weapon by a Prohibited Person, while Diana Thomas, 68, faces seven total charges, including two counts of Possession with Intent to Distribute within 1,000 feet of a Playground.


According to Dundy County Sheriff Ryan King, deputies served a search warrant at two homes on South Porter Avenue in Haigler on August 12.


At Cox’s home, deputies seized 36 items, including around three ounces of
methamphetamine, cash, a digital scale, three rifles, and a walking cane containing a sword.


Records say at Thomas’s home, 23 items were found, including 60 blue fentanyl pills, a needle with methamphetamine residue, and a digital scale.


Both of their homes are within 400 feet of Haigler’s city park.


The sheriff’s office says Cox’s bond was set at $250,000, while Thomas’s bond was set at $100,000.

It’s not known if they have been arrested.
